Suicides increase in Israel

In 2003 occurred 417 suicides in Israel. This year, 37 more people committed suicide than in 2002. In Israel, on average, at least one suicide happens every day.

Israel had 6.2 suicides per 100,000 inhabitants, much less than the average suicide in the world, of 10.69 self-harm per 100.000 people.

Of the 417 recorded suicide cases in 2003, 345 were men suicides and 72 were women. Men have a very high rate of death by suicide compared with women. So that, the suicide rate among males were 10.4 per 100,000 men and for women 2.1 per 100,000 female.

Statistics show that in 2014, suicides were the main cause of unnatural death in the world. In Israel suicide also is one of the leading causes of unnatural death. By comparison, there were 171 homicides in Israel, suicides far outnumber homicides. For every homicide there were 2.4 suicides.
